scrcc
Stealth scrcpy Client
Mirror and control your Android device inside a protected desktop window. Fast access to your mobile workflow during meetings and interviews — no context switching, no interruptions.
Core Features
Everything you need for controlled Android mirroring on desktop.
Content Protection
Window-level protection flags keep the mirror view out of screen-sharing pipelines.
Alt-Tab Hidden
The app stays off the Alt-Tab switcher so your taskbar stays clean during calls.
Mouse Pass-Through
Toggle click-through mode so the window never interferes with your primary workflow.
Full Input Control
Keyboard forwarding, touch injection, Android nav buttons, and clipboard sync.
USB & Wireless
Auto-detect USB devices or connect over wireless ADB. Auto-reconnect on drop.
Performance Tuning
Resolution up to 2560, bitrate 1–16 Mbps, FPS 15–60. Tune to your hardware profile.
Overlay Mode
Always-on-top, adjustable opacity 10–100%, compact mini mode, persistent window bounds.
Quick Session Stop
One-key emergency stop kills the session and hides the window in milliseconds.
Focus Guard
Clicking the window doesn't steal focus from your active meeting or interview app.
How It Works
Three layers that put your Android workflow inside your desktop environment.
Off-Screen Capture
scrcpy spawns completely off-screen. The raw stream is captured by Electron's desktop capturer.
Desktop Render
The Android stream is rendered into a <video> element inside a controlled Electron window.
Window Protection
OS-level display affinity flags are applied so the window produces a blank in any capture pipeline.
// Content protection → window appears blank in any capture tool
mainWindow.setContentProtection(true);
// Confirmed blank in:
// ✓ OBS Studio
// ✓ Discord screen share
// ✓ Microsoft Teams
// ✓ Zoom
// ✓ Windows Snipping Tool
Hotkeys
Keyboard shortcuts for live session control.
| Hotkey | Action |
|---|---|
|
Ctrl Shift S
|
Show / hide the app window |
|
Ctrl Shift D
|
Toggle mouse pass-through |
|
Ctrl
Shift
Q
|
Emergency stop — kill session, hide window |
Privacy & Usage
scrcc is designed for authorized device workflows — mirroring and controlling your own Android device during meetings, interviews, and live desktop sessions. All communication is local (ADB over USB or local Wi-Fi). No data is exfiltrated or intercepted. Users are responsible for ensuring usage complies with their organization's policies and applicable laws.
Real-World Use Cases
Built for operators who need reliable Android context during live desktop sessions.
Interviews and Hiring Loops
Reference mobile chat, OTP flows, and candidate coordination apps without breaking the interview pace.
Meetings and Live Demos
Keep mobile app state visible while presenting from desktop, with hotkeys for instant control.
Support and Operations
Triage app behavior, reproduce user-reported mobile flows, and respond faster during calls.
QA and Workflow Testing
Run controlled device checks alongside desktop tooling without physically switching devices.
System and Session Specs
| Platform | Windows 10 or later, 64-bit |
|---|---|
| Device Connection | ADB over USB and local Wi-Fi |
| Resolution Range | Up to 2560 (configurable) |
| Frame Rate | 15 to 60 FPS |
| Bitrate | 1 to 16 Mbps |
| Control Features | Keyboard forwarding, touch injection, clipboard sync, always-on-top, opacity control |
Quick Setup in 4 Steps
STEP 1
Install and launch
Download Portable or Setup build, then launch scrcc on Windows.
STEP 2
Connect your Android device
Use USB for maximum stability or switch to wireless ADB after pairing.
STEP 3
Tune stream quality
Set resolution, FPS, and bitrate to match your CPU, network, and meeting workflow.
STEP 4
Use hotkeys in-session
Toggle visibility, pass-through mode, and emergency stop without losing focus.
Frequently Asked Questions
Does scrcc work over both USB and Wi-Fi?
Yes. USB gives the most stable baseline. Wireless ADB is supported for cable-free workflows.
Can I tune quality for performance?
Yes. Adjust FPS, bitrate, and resolution to optimize smoothness versus resource usage.
Is this intended for authorized use?
Yes. Use scrcc only with devices and environments where you have explicit permission and policy compliance.
Where can I report issues?
Open an issue on GitHub with device model, Android version, Windows build, and session settings.
Ready to download?
Get scrcc for Windows and bring your Android workflow into your desktop sessions.
Windows 10+ · 64-bit · Portable ~70 MB · Setup ~50 MB